Headline:
Flash Flood Warning issued May 25 at 8:33PM CDT until May 25 at 10:00PM CDT by NWS Lubbock TX
Event:
Flash Flood Warning
Urgency:
Immediate
Effective:
May 25, 2025 - 6:33pm
Expires:
May 25, 2025 - 8:00pm
Description:
At 833 PM CDT, Doppler radar indicated decreasing thunderstorms
activity across the warned area. However, up to 2 inches of rain
have fallen. Additional rainfall amounts up to 0.5 inches are
possible in the warned area. Flash flooding is ongoing or expected
to begin shortly.
HAZARD...Flash flooding caused by thunderstorms.
SOURCE...Radar.
IMPACT...Flash flooding of small creeks and streams, urban areas,
highways and streets as well as other poor drainage and
low-lying areas.
Some locations that will experience flash flooding include...
Earth, Sudan and Needmore.
Instruction:
Turn around, don't dr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ood
deaths occur in vehicles.
Be aware of your surroundings and do not drive on flooded roads.
Area Description:
Bailey, TX; Castro, TX; Lamb, TX; Parmer, TX
